在JS中编写HTML代码的方法
使用document.createElement方法
在JavaScript中,可以使用document.createElement方法动态创建HTML元素。这种方法允许开发者创建不同类型的DOM元素,通过JavaScript的API将它们添加到页面中。使用这种方法的好处是可以在页面加载后进行元素的创建和插入,不会对HTML源代码产生直接影响。以下是使用document.createElement的基本步骤:
使用document.createElement方法创建一个新的HTML元素,一个
内联HTML与innerHTML属性
另一种在JavaScript中写入HTML代码的常用方法是使用innerHTML属性。通过将innerHTML属性赋予一段有效的HTML字符串,开发者可以快速修改某一元素的内容。这种方法适用于较简单的内容更新。使用innerHTML时需要注意,赋值的字符串中不能包含错误的HTML语法,否则可能导致未预期的结果。
,可以选择一个特定的DOM元素,如一个
使用模板字符串
ES6引入了模板字符串的功能,允许开发者在JavaScript中以更灵活的方式构建多行和复杂的HTML结构。模板字符串使用反引号(`)定义,可以包含变量和表达式的插值,极大地简化了HTML的生成过程。,可以定义一个HTML模板,并在插值中动态填充数据,从而生成最终的HTML内容。这种方法提高了可读性和可维护性,尤其当涉及较复杂的HTML结构时。
JavaScript为在网页中动态生成和修改HTML提供了多种方法,包括document.createElement、innerHTML属性以及使用模板字符串。根据项目需求和具体上下文选择适当的方式,有助于提升开发效率与代码的清晰度。